Description

When Su Jinyu held Gu Peilang’s bloody corpse, he still couldn’t react. He couldn’t believe that the man who was supposed to spend his honeymoon with his newlywed wife in the United States would appear in front of him covered in blood, protect him from an explosion with his broken body, and fight for him. After the aftermath of the explosion, he took his last breath in his arms because of excessive blood loss. Gu Yin, who came in a hurry, looked at the lost youth in the ruins. When he left with Gu Peilang’s body in his arms, he cursed at the person on the ground: “You will never realize how much he loved you, Su Jinyu.”“Su Jinyu, just keep living like this, with the guilt towards him and the guilt of the Su family……..just…… keep on living.”

## My Thoughts on I Was Wrong, Please Don’t Leave Me "I Was Wrong, Please Don’t Leave Me" is a story that promises a rollercoaster of emotions, and judging from my experience, it delivers, albeit with some sharp turns that might not be for everyone. The novel dives deep into themes of regret, redemption, and the complexities of love, all wrapped up in a mature and often tragic package. ### First Impressions Going in, I knew I was in for a heavy read. The tags alone – adult, drama, psychological, tragedy – prepared me for a story that wouldn't shy away from difficult themes. The premise, hinting at a second chance for a protagonist who seemingly messed up big time in his first life, piqued my interest. I was curious to see how the author would navigate the redemption arc, and whether I could find myself rooting for a character who starts off on such shaky ground. ### What Works Well The emotional depth of the story is definitely its strongest point. The author does a commendable job of portraying the male lead's devotion and the hurt he endured. The scenes where he confronts the protagonist with the pain of the past are particularly powerful. There's a raw honesty in his words that really resonated with me. The story explores the consequences of past actions, and the journey towards forgiveness feels earned, even if it's not always easy to watch. ### Areas of Concern However, I have some reservations. The initial portrayal of the protagonist is quite problematic, to say the least. His actions and attitudes in his first life are difficult to stomach, and it takes a while to warm up to him, even with the promise of redemption. Additionally, the presence of non-consensual situations is a significant trigger warning that potential readers should be aware of. These elements, while perhaps serving the plot, can be off-putting and detract from the overall experience. ### ⚠️ Spoiler Warning Several elements of the story are mentioned that could be considered spoilers. Specifically, the protagonist's initial negative treatment of the male lead, the reasons behind the male lead's initial love for the protagonist, and the presence of non-consensual situations (including one involving the main couple) are all mentioned. If you prefer to go in blind, proceed with caution. ### Final Verdict "I Was Wrong, Please Don’t Leave Me" is a complex and emotionally charged novel that explores themes of regret, redemption, and the enduring power of love. While the problematic elements and difficult themes might not appeal to all readers, those who are willing to delve into a story with morally gray characters and a heavy dose of angst will find something to appreciate here. I'd recommend it with a strong caveat: be aware of the trigger warnings and be prepared for a potentially uncomfortable, but ultimately thought-provoking, read.
